New DOD Program Funds $500 Million for Small Business

June 3, 2010

Included in the National Defense Authorization Act For Fiscal Year 2011 was a new program within the Department of Defense created for the purpose of accelerating and supporting defense technology transition to the warfighter or commercial markets.  Called the "Rapid Innovation Program", it would create a new $500 million pool of funding for small businesses to compete over.  This money would be targeted to "accelerate" technologies from the prototype phase to the field or market place.  Although the bill has passed the House, the program needs to go through the Appriopriations Committee before any money can be allocated.
